From: Jonathan Santos Date: Sun, 24 Aug 2025 04:10:03 +0000 (-0300) Subject: iio: adc: ad7768-1: use devm_regulator_get_enable_read_voltage() X-Git-Tag: v6.18-rc1~74^2~7^2~69 X-Git-Url: http://git.ipfire.org/gitweb.cgi?a=commitdiff_plain;h=91812d3843409c235f336f32f1c37ddc790f1e03;p=thirdparty%2Fkernel%2Fstable.git iio: adc: ad7768-1: use devm_regulator_get_enable_read_voltage() Use devm_regulator_get_enable_read_voltage() function as a standard and concise way of reading the voltage from the regulator and keep the regulator enabled. Replace the regulator descriptor with the direct voltage value in the device struct.
